In the following passage, some of the words have been left out, each of which is indicated by a letter. Find the suitable word from the options given against each letter and fill up the blanks with appropriate words to make the paragraph meaningful.

Digital India can be the prime _____ 1 _____ behind making a reality of the government’s promise of minimum government, maximum governance. Such a transformation requires technology to be firmly _____ 2 _____ into government, something that the Digital India project lists as one of its foremost objectives. Embedding technology into government _____ 3 _____ will do three things; transform the government and make it more transparent and efficient, transform the lives of citizens especially those at the bottom of _____ 4 _____ pyramid and make our economy more efficient and competitive. A 2014 McKinsey Global Institute report predicts that the large- scale _____ 5 _____ of technology through Digital India positions India with the biggest opportunity yet to accelerate economic growth.

Find the appropriate word in case 1 .

  1. A.

    factors

  2. B.

    might

  3. C.

    force

  4. D.

    impact

Correct answer: C

Answer: The correct word is force.

Why this fits:

  • force — Fits because it denotes a driving power or agent. The phrase "the prime ___ behind" calls for a singular noun naming the main motivating power, which "force" provides.

  • factors — Does not fit because it is plural and the sentence needs a singular noun representing one principal driving power.

  • might — Unsuitable here: although it can be a noun meaning power, it is primarily a modal verb and would be awkward and unclear in this construction.

  • impact — Incorrect because it denotes an effect or result, whereas the sentence needs the cause or driving agent, not the outcome.

Therefore, "force" is the most appropriate choice both grammatically and semantically.
